If your toilet is flushing properly and not "glub glubing" then most likely your air vent is NOT plugged although that could be the source of your odor. I would thoroughly flush & clean rinse the black tank using as much water pressure as possible. Keep flushing until the water comes out clear. Close your valve add about 10 gallons of water & triple dose with toilet chemical. Unfortunately the trailer being stationary won't allow much movement of the water in the tank, but the fumes from the chemical should work their magic. Let it sit for a few hours & begin flushing to check if the odor still exists. If not your tank just needed a good cleaning, if you now smell the chemicals I would think that the air vent is the culprit. Also put chemical in the gray tank as they have a tendency to create a sewer smell. I hope that helps!
